Appium环境搭建

作者: adonisjph | 来源:发表于2016-07-29 15:09 被阅读127次

    环境背景

    本次环境搭建基于win10(x64)系统。

    所需软件

    安装步骤

    配置JAVA环境

    众所周知,Android是由Java语言开发的,所以想开发Android应用首先需要Java环境,所以,我们首先需要安装Java环境。

    • java 环境分JDK 和JRE ,JDK就是Java Development Kit.简单的说JDK是面向开发人员使用的SDK,它提供了Java的开发环境和运行环境。JRE是Java Runtime Enviroment是指Java的运行环境,是面向Java程序的使用者,而不是开发者。

    双击下载的JDK ,设置安装路径。这里我们选择默认安装在
    D:\Program Files (x86)\Java\jdk1.8.0_25目录下。
    下面设置环境变量:

    Paste_Image.png

    “此电脑”右键菜单--->属性--->高级--->环境变量--->系统变量-->新建

    变量名:JAVA_HOME 
    
    变量值:C:\Program Files\Java\jdk1.7.0_79
    
    变量名:CALSS_PATH
    
    变量值:.;%JAVA_HOME%\lib;%JAVA_HOME%\lib\tools.jar
    

    找到path变量名—>“编辑”添加:

    变量名:PATH
    
    变量值:%JAVA_HOME%\bin;%JAVA_HOME%\jre\bin;
    
    

    在Windows命令提示符下验证java是否成功:

    Paste_Image.png Paste_Image.png
    
    C:\Users\fnngj>java
    用法: java [-options] class [args...]
               (执行类)
       或  java [-options] -jar jarfile [args...]
               (执行 jar 文件)
    
    其中选项包括:
        -d32          使用 32 位数据模型 (如果可用)
        -d64          使用 64 位数据模型 (如果可用)
        -server       选择 "server" VM
        -hotspot      是 "server" VM 的同义词 [已过时]
                      默认 VM 是 server.
    
    
     
    C:\Users\fnngj>javac
    用法: javac <options> <source files>
    其中, 可能的选项包括:
      -g                         生成所有调试信息
      -g:none                    不生成任何调试信息
      -g:{lines,vars,source}     只生成某些调试信息
      -nowarn                    不生成任何警告
      -verbose                   输出有关编译器正在执行的操作的消息
      -deprecation               输出使用已过时的 API 的源位置
      -classpath <路径>            指定查找用户类文件和注释处理程序的位置
      -cp <路径>                   指定查找用户类文件和注释处理程序的位置
    
    

    java命令可以运行class文件字节码。

    javac命令可以将java源文件编译为class字节码文件

    安装android SDK

    Android SDK:

    Android SDK提供了你的API库和开发工具构建,测试和调试应用程序,Android。简单来讲,Android SDK 可以看做用于开发和运行Android应用的一个软件

    下面设置Android环境变量,方法与java环境变量类似。我本机的目录结果为:

    C:\Program Files (x86)\Android\android-sdk

    下面设置环境变量:

    “我的电脑”右键菜单--->属性--->高级--->环境变量--->系统变量-->新建..

    变量名:ANDROID_HOME 
    
    变量值:C:\Program Files (x86)\Android\android-sdk
    
    Paste_Image.png

    找到path变量名—>“编辑”添加:

    变量名:PATH
    
    变量值:;%ANDROID_HOME%\platform-tools;%ANDROID_HOME%\tools;
    
    Paste_Image.png

    安装nodejs

    去官网选择对应的系统版本进行下载即可,下载后安装

    Paste_Image.png

    安装完成,打开Windows 命令提示符,敲入“node -v”命令回车。
    如下图显示便是安装成功

    Paste_Image.png

    SDK Manager安装模拟器

    双击启动SDK Manager.exe 程序

    Paste_Image.png

    由于在天朝的缘故,所以sdk是不可以更新的,需要设置代理才可以。接下来设置一下代理
    在Android SDK Manager 的菜单栏上点击“Tools”---->“Options...”设置相关代码,如下图:

    Paste_Image.png

    然后就可以更新了,此处需要将Android SDK Tools以及Android SDK Platform-tools勾选,然后选择几个版本的API下载

    Paste_Image.png

    点击install packages后,点击accept license,再点击install等待安装完成

    Paste_Image.png

    安装Appium

    这里不推荐使用npm在线安装,直接去官网下载

    Paste_Image.png

    下载完成后解压安装,安装完成后双击桌面的Appium图标,如下图:

    Paste_Image.png

    之后将appium添加到path中,如下图:

    Paste_Image.png

    打开命令提示符,输入"appium-doctor",如下图所示便为安装成功

    Paste_Image.png

    到此,appium的环境搭建便已结束

    相关文章

      网友评论

        本文标题:Appium环境搭建

        本文链接:https://www.haomeiwen.com/subject/ufszjttx.html